Photo of Jim Buchanan


Jim Buchanan

James Forrest Buchanan

Position: Pitcher
Bats: Left, Throws: Right
Height: 5' 10", Weight: 165 lb.

Born: July 1, 1876 in Chatham Hill, VA
Schools: Austin College (Sherman, TX), Midland Lutheran College (Fremont, NE)(All Transactions)
Debut: April 16, 1905
Team: Browns 1905

Final Game: October 7, 1905
Died: June 15, 1949 in Norfolk, NE
Buried: Randolph Cemetery, Randolph, NE
